    Shirley H.

    The first thing was the system stopped working. Second, I ordered a jasmine milk tea with boba. The drink wasn't sweet at all and she didn't give me tapioca boba, neither did she even give me much at all (as advertised all over the shop. She gave me crystal boba (agar boba) but not the tapioca. The lady was nice, but probably won't come here again.

    Gail J.

    Yikes! This might be the first one star I've ever given, usually opting to leave no review other than a bad one. But the owners need to be warned. I really was looking forward to eating here, having had a memorably delicious Korean corn dog in Las Vegas. I was feeling lucky when I could walk straight up to the counter to order my half-half cheese/"beef" hotdog potato dog. I tried to order a mochi donut but they were all out (at 12:05pm?). I was handed the wrong KDog at the counter. By the time the other customer BROUGHT BACK the Potato Dog I ordered it wasn't hot and had lost some of its crunch. Ok. Now I'm hungry. Ugh. They fried it in really old oil. And the batter was akin to yesterday's pancake batter. Doughy, dense, and bland. My throat and tongue feel weird. Wish I had just spat it out. My NOLA experience before this was that I couldn't get a bad meal in New Orleans. Mochi XO proved me wrong.

    I was shopping on Magazine Street when I decided on a whim to eat here for lunch. Even though I…read moredecided to dine indoors, it was the outdoor patio dining area that drew me in with all the colorful seating and canopy above the tables. The decor inside is just as vibrant and colorful as it is outdoors. Fun paintings on the wall. There's a bar on the left hand side and booth seating on the right. You walk to the back to order and seat yourself. Cute drawing of a dog lying in a bun on the side of the napkin holder. The menu is above the counter, and it's a bit overwhelming. Who knew there were so many options for sausages. I decided on the Vegan Chipotle Sausage ($12.50). The list of toppings is even more extensive, which you can leave up to the chef, so you can guess, I decided to leave it up to the chef. I also purchased a fountain drink ($3.15). You give them your name when you pay, and they deliver your order to your table. While I was waiting, I also got a non-alcoholic drink at the bar, a Pacific Breeze ($5). It consisted of pineapple, passion fruit puree, and soda water. A deliciousness cold drink on a hot day. Staff called out my name and delivered my food. Wow! It was one loaded dog. Delicious. I approved of the toppings. If I had chosen, I may have over done it. Staff are super friendly. They were patient when ordering. I enjoyed the relaxed, chill environment. There's also a free standing ATM machine for your convenience.

    Dat Dog is this great and fun, for lack of a better term, hotdog stand. This is a really fun little…read morebusiness on Magazine Street. Basically, you go into it, walk to the back of the shop, order up what you want, and go to your table and they'll bring it to you. Simple as that. They have a truly unique section of food orientated items. My favorite is there alligator sausage dog. But, they have all sizes and shapes of food offerings, including some designed for the vegans out there. Of course, have other items as well. So, even though this place, at least by my understanding, is focused on dogs, you can't find other fun items to eat here, as well. This location also has a self standing bar. From there, you can grab a great selection of beers, cocktails, and mocktails if that's your preference. At the bar, you order separately from ordering your food. Thus, you can have a great experience if you just want to come in and just have a drink and sit back at the bar. You can even talk to the bartender if you want to. Very nice. In terms of layout, they have interior seating, some booths along the one wall, plus a very expensive outdoor patio. So, weather permitting, if you're interested in breathing in some fresh air while you enjoy whatever it is you're eating and drinking at this establishment, it's a great place to do it. Overall, this is a really fun restaurant. I recommend you go there.
